Using Apple Pay is straightforward. First, you'll need an Apple device and a compatible bank card. Once your card is added to your Apple Wallet, you can select Apple Pay as your deposit method at participating online casinos. When prompted, you'll typically authenticate the transaction using Face ID, Touch ID, or your passcode. The casino doesn't receive your card details; instead, a unique device account number is used, enhancing security.
Security is a major benefit of using Apple Pay. All transactions are encrypted, and your actual card details are not shared with the casino. Moreover, the authentication process adds an extra layer of protection, preventing unauthorized use of your card. This makes Apple Pay a more secure option than manually entering your card details.
